Multi-point locking systems

A safe door is a crucial element of any property. Installing a multipoint lock will improve the security of your home. Multipoint locks feature deadbolts at multiple points along the length of the door's frame, which is not possible with traditional single-point locks. This makes them more difficult to gain entry and gives you peace of mind knowing that your home is safe from intruders who aren't yours to keep.

Numerous manufacturers make multipoint locks that can be fitted on sliding doors bromley doors, french doors, and single entry doors. Some models have a central deadbolt as well as a livebolt and hook bolts at the top and bottom panels. These bolts can be locked using keys or a handle. The locking points are then rotated to create an airtight seal.

Choosing the appropriate multipoint lock system for your home will rely on a variety of variables. Be aware of the level security you require in addition to your family's lifestyle and needs. If you have children who are small A lock that is easy to use by them, but is difficult to use for intruders, may be the best option.

Multipoint locking systems that have high security and insurance approval are a great option to improve the security of your home. They also help in increasing energy efficiency as they create a tighter seal to keep out rain and cold air.

Sash jammers

Sash jammers are a sought-after additional security feature for doors and windows. They are simple to set up and inexpensive. They can be utilized on uPVC doors and windows which open outwards or inwards. They are simple to operate, using a turn of the Jammer Arm locking or releasing the sash.

They're a good burglar deterrent as they provide an extra obstacle for criminals to climb over when attempting to gain entry into your home. They also keep windows from being open in a forced entry scenario, protecting your home from burglars who may try to make use of the window fitter bromley as an escape route should they be trapped inside.

Sash Jammers can also be useful in preventing your uPVC door or window from being opened by pets, children or other guests. They are easy to install and removed just by turning the arm, ensuring peace of mind for family members.

There are both non-locking and locking sash jammers that are available therefore it is crucial to find out which one is right for you. You should consider a premium key locking version, as it's more secure and can be operated from outside. Talk to a reputable lock specialist when you're not sure what sash-jammer to buy. They will be able to offer advice and make recommendations that suit your home.
